MINI Hatchback1.5 Cooper Classic II 3dr201952,607 milesPetrol£9,995or £214 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£213.33, Customer Deposit: £1,499.00, Total Deposit: £1,499.25, Total Charge For Credit: £1,745.09, Total Amount Payable: £11,740.09,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%Read more
MINI Convertible1.5 Cooper II 2dr201812,245 milesPetrol£12,995or £278 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£277.37, Customer Deposit: £1,949.00, Total Deposit: £1,949.25, Total Charge For Credit: £2,269.01, Total Amount Payable: £15,264.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%Read more
MINI Hatchback2.0 Cooper S II 3dr201817,547 milesPetrol£14,295or £306 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£305.12, Customer Deposit: £2,144.00, Total Deposit: £2,144.25, Total Charge For Credit: £2,496.01, Total Amount Payable: £16,791.01,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%Read more
BMW X3xDrive M50 5dr Auto20253,000 milesHybrid£65,888or £921 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£920.74, Customer Deposit: £9,883.00, Total Deposit: £9,883.20, Optional Final Payment: £29,133.23, Total Charge For Credit: £16,403.21, Total Amount Payable: £82,291.21,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 18.41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to20252,500 milesPetrol£38,999or £529 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£528.76, Customer Deposit: £5,849.00, Total Deposit: £5,849.85, Optional Final Payment: £18,170.20, Total Charge For Credit: £9,872.77, Total Amount Payable: £48,871.77,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.95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series520i M Sport Pro 4dr Auto20252,500 milesHybrid£48,999or £672 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£671.43, Customer Deposit: £7,349.00, Total Deposit: £7,349.85, Optional Final Payment: £22,425.11, Total Charge For Credit: £12,333.17, Total Amount Payable: £61,332.17,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 15.81ppm, Mileage Per Annum: 10,000Read more
BMW X2sDrive 20i M Sport 5dr Step Auto20252,000 milesHybrid£41,888or £581 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£580.31, Customer Deposit: £6,283.00, Total Deposit: £6,283.20, Optional Final Payment: £18,809.30, Total Charge For Credit: £10,479.07, Total Amount Payable: £52,367.07,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.85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ran CoupeM235 xDrive 4dr Step Auto20252,000 milesPetrol£45,888or £637 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£636.96, Customer Deposit: £6,883.00, Total Deposit: £6,883.20, Optional Final Payment: £20,535.38, Total Charge For Credit: £11,467.70, Total Amount Payable: £57,355.70,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 15.64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e220 M Sport 4dr Step Auto20252,000 milesHybrid£32,999or £438 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£437.75, Customer Deposit: £4,949.00, Total Deposit: £4,949.85, Optional Final Payment: £15,926.59, Total Charge For Credit: £8,451.69, Total Amount Payable: £41,450.69,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.40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ive 30e M Sport 5dr Auto20253,000 milesHybrid£59,999or £831 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£830.76, Customer Deposit: £8,999.00, Total Deposit: £8,999.85, Optional Final Payment: £26,968.04, Total Charge For Credit: £15,014.61, Total Amount Payable: £75,013.61,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 17.06ppm, Mileage Per Annum: 10,000Read more
BMW X7xDrive40d MHT M Sport 5dr Step Auto20253,000 milesHybrid£83,999or £1,074 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,073.46, Customer Deposit: £12,599.00, Total Deposit: £12,599.85, Optional Final Payment: £42,871.48, Total Charge For Credit: £21,924.95, Total Amount Payable: £105,923.95,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 21.25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e220 M Sport 4dr Step Auto20252,500 milesHybrid£36,888or £524 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£523.06, Customer Deposit: £5,533.00, Total Deposit: £5,533.20, Optional Final Payment: £15,878.01, Total Charge For Credit: £9,107.03, Total Amount Payable: £45,995.03,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.40ppm, Mileage Per Annum: 10,000Read more
BMW X1sDrive 20i MHT M Sport 5dr Step Auto20253,000 milesHybrid£38,555or £524 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£523.16, Customer Deposit: £5,783.00, Total Deposit: £5,783.25, Optional Final Payment: £17,939.52, Total Charge For Credit: £9,756.29, Total Amount Payable: £48,311.29,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.62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series420i M Sport 2dr Step Auto20253,000 milesPetrol£41,777or £608 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£607.61, Customer Deposit: £6,266.00, Total Deposit: £6,266.55, Optional Final Payment: £17,113.61, Total Charge For Credit: £10,160.83, Total Amount Payable: £51,937.83,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 12.25ppm, Mileage Per Annum: 10,000Read more
BMW X1xDrive 23i MHT xLine 5dr Step Auto20253,427 milesHybrid£37,888or £519 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£518.59, Customer Deposit: £5,683.00, Total Deposit: £5,683.20, Optional Final Payment: £17,373.46, Total Charge For Credit: £9,542.39, Total Amount Payable: £47,430.39,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 11.34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Active Tourer225e xDrive M Sport 5dr DCT20253,000 milesHybrid£35,888or £522 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£521.41, Customer Deposit: £5,383.00, Total Deposit: £5,383.20, Optional Final Payment: £14,732.42, Total Charge For Credit: £8,733.89, Total Amount Payable: £44,621.89,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 10.25ppm, Mileage Per Annum: 10,000Read more
BMW 1 SeriesM135 xDrive 5dr Step Auto20251,360 milesPetrol£37,333or £475 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£474.55, Customer Deposit: £5,599.00, Total Deposit: £5,599.95, Optional Final Payment: £19,199.47, Total Charge For Credit: £9,770.27, Total Amount Payable: £47,103.27,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 15.26ppm, Mileage Per Annum: 10,000Read more
BMW X3xDrive20d M Sport 5dr Step Auto20257,077 milesDiesel£51,000or £707 mo39 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£706.81, Customer Deposit: £7,650.00, Total Deposit: £7,650.00, Optional Final Payment: £22,886.24, Total Charge For Credit: £12,756.31, Total Amount Payable: £63,756.31, Representative APR: 9.90%, Interest Rate (Fixed): 9.90%, Excess Mileage Charge: 13.13ppm, Mileage Per Annum: 10,000Read more